Marshall firefighters were toned out after an alarm was sounded at and a 9-1-1 call was placed from Rose Acre Farms on Friday, January 22. According to a fire-department spokesperson, fire fighters were dispatched at 4:11 a.m. They arrived on the scene at 123 North Miami Avenue at 4:17 a.m. The alarm was sounded when a person on the scene started smelling smoke. Upon arrival, firefighters noted moderate smoke in the east end of the building. Firemen did a search of the building with no fire found. They opened doors to let the building ventilate. Upon further investigation, firefighters found a room that had been on fire before their arrival. But due to the doors being closed, the blaze extinguished itself. They ventilated that room and made sure the fire was out and no further spread had occurred. ....
Get a taste of Mexico with a healthy spin courtesy of newcomer Ojo De Agua. The popular chain, which boasts more than 35 locations in locations throughout Mexico, has debuted its first U.S. outpost inside the SLS Lux Brickell (851 South Miami Avenue). Ojo De Agua serves up an extensive menu featuring an all-day breakfast with items like açaí bowls, huevos casuela, cinnamon toast French toast rolls, chilaquiles, and more. A variety of tacos filled with items like spicy tuna, octopus, and ribeye can be found, alongside an extensive offering of sandwiches, wraps, salads, and bowls. Interior of Ojo De Agua ....

Lorain County CSI said the same Grinch who stole packages and destroyed Christmas decorations on Saturday stuck again, this time stealing more packages on Wednesday. Both acts were caught on tape. Lorain County CSI said the first incident happened near the 2400 block of Cleveland Boulevard on Dec. 12. The suspect was wearing a stocking cap, white mask, dark jeans, and white and black shoes, and drove off in a dark gray SUV that appears to be a Nissan Murano or Rogue, according to Lorain County CSI. ....

According to the U.S. Marshal’s Office, Lamar Horsey, 27, was taken into custody by members of the Northern Ohio Violent Fugitive Task Force at a bus stop near Forest Hills Boulevard and Superior Avenue in East Cleveland. Authorities say Horsey ran when officers tried to take him into custody. A K9 was released and bit Horsey, who then was arrested without further incident. ....
